The Code Embed WordPress plugin prior to version 2.6.1 is vulnerable to stored Cross-Site Scripting (XSS) through the external URL embed feature in post content. The vulnerable code scans rendered content for URL embed tokens, fetches the remote URL, and inserts the remote response body into the page without output sanitization or an `unfiltered_html` capability check. This allows a Contributor attacker to submit a pending post containing an inert-looking URL token that executes attacker-controlled JavaScript when an Administrator or Editor previews or reviews the post. This is distinct from CVE-2026-2512, which affected custom field meta values up to version 2.5.1. This vector affects version 2.6 and uses the documented external URL embed feature in post content.
